One of the few stalwarts of the ever-changing Surry Hills restaurant scene, Matsuri Japanese Restaurant has been a reasonably regular haunt of mine for nearly nine years. The excellent value wooden boats laden with sushi and sashimi are the lure. It’s generally best to forgo entrees, but a tempting bowl of Agedashi Tofu ($8.50) on the specials menu speaks to my dining companion. The plump deep fried eggplant pieces sit in a lovely sweet broth flavoured with light soy, ground radish and seaweed. I succumb to another special – Zucchini Flower Tempura ($9.50) – and am not disappointed. When our Sushi and Sashimi Combination Boat ($52.50) arrives we struggle to finish the nicely presented sashimi, nigiri sushi, inside-out rolls and nori rolls. Everything on the boat is fresh and plentiful though not all pieces are matched for easy sharing; it could probably feed three people. Restaurant décor has always been minimal, but seems to have declined further in recent times. I also note that they’ve gone to no BYO since my last visit. Their wine list is small and uninspired, with nearly everything including a 2007 Devil’s Lair Fifth Leg White ($31/bottle, $10/glass) also available by the glass. Food is usually consistent; staff may disappoint.
